CCMC collects 18.27 crores tax in three days.

Today, is the third day of the taxation drive initiated by the City Corporation announcing acceptance of demonetised 500's and 1000's from the public. Today, an amount of 2.54 crores has been collected towards tax dues from the public, says Special Officer Vijayakarthikeyan. 

Zone-wise break-up:

East - 54.83 lakhs

West - 51.83 lakhs

South - 29.51 lakhs

North - 57.53 lakhs

Central - 60.46 lakhs. 

So far, a total of 18.27 crores has been collected from 11th November till today. And, tomorrow being the last date for paying taxes through demonetised 500's and 1000's it is expected that the collection amount could increase notably.
